>> Support the LTC4283 Hot Swap Controller. The device features programmable
>> current limit with foldback and independently adjustable inrush current to
>> optimize the MOSFET safe operating area (SOA). The SOA timer limits MOSFET
>> temperature rise for reliable protection against overstresses.
>>
>> An I2C interface and onboard ADC allow monitoring of board current,
>> voltage, power, energy, and fault status.
